Intended Use

The Linvatec UltraFix® Knotless MiniMite® Suture Anchor is intended for reattaching soft tissue to glenoid bone in the shoulder. The following are the indications for use: Bankart lesion repairs, SLAP lesion repairs, capsular shift, capsulolabral reconstructions.

Device Story

UltraFix Knotless MiniMite Suture Anchor is a mechanical bone fixation device; used for reattaching soft tissue to glenoid bone in shoulder. Device functions as a fastener to secure tissue during orthopedic procedures such as Bankart lesion repair, SLAP lesion repair, capsular shift, and capsulolabral reconstructions. Operated by orthopedic surgeons in clinical/OR settings. Provides mechanical fixation to facilitate healing of soft tissue to bone.

Regulatory Classification

Identification

A smooth or threaded metallic bone fixation fastener is a device intended to be implanted that consists of a stiff wire segment or rod made of alloys, such as cobalt-chromium-molybdenum and stainless steel, and that may be smooth on the outside, fully or partially threaded, straight or U-shaped; and may be either blunt pointed, sharp pointed, or have a formed, slotted head on the end. It may be used for fixation of bone fractures, for bone reconstructions, as a guide pin for insertion of other implants, or it may be implanted through the skin so that a pulling force (traction) may be applied to the skeletal system.
